We’re proud to share that Robert Schomp, one of our water resources engineers, was recently featured on Chat with Change Makers, a student-led series produced by DiscoverE that highlights careers in science, technology, engineering, and math.
In the episode, Robert sat down with Luke, a high school student, to discuss his career designing river habitats for salmon, his role as a community college instructor, and his involvement with the American Society of Civil Engineers (ASCE). Together, they explored what it means to build a career in civil engineering and the pathways that can lead students into impactful, purpose-driven work.
